vue 按需加载 require.ensure ,感觉中间的加载时间有可能部分页面加载比较慢,导致等待的
时间比较长,怎么解决啊?
3条回答 默认 最新
- 关注
码龄 粉丝数 原力等级 --
- 被采纳
- 被点赞
- 采纳率
jingluan666 2020-08-26 11:14最佳回答 专家已采纳采纳该答案 已采纳该答案 专家已采纳评论解决 无用打赏举报微信扫一扫
分享评论登录 后可回复...
查看更多回答(2条)
报告相同问题?
提交
相关推荐 更多相似问题
- 2020-08-26 10:57回答 3 已采纳 如果你用的是webpack,可以看看这个 https://stackoverflow.com/questions/43341878/slow-webpack-build-time-advanced-
- 2018-10-30 10:00回答 3 已采纳 输入域名后,网页直接加载打包后的`index.html` , 你只要在`Vue router`里面设置好根节点就行了吧
- 2021-05-20 12:34回答 1 已采纳 // 构建多页面应用,页面的配置 pages: { index: { // page 的入口 entry: 'src/ind
- 2021-12-06 17:48Alex-MingL的博客 vue项目实现路由按需加载(路由懒加载)的3种方式 1.vue异步组件 2.es提案的import() 3.webpack的require,ensur *1.vue异步组件技术 ==== 异步加载 vue-router配置路由 , 使用vue的异步组件技术 , 可以实现按需加载 . ...
- 2021-06-13 09:55先看评测的博客 import Vue from 'vue'import Router from 'vue-router'Vue.use(Router)// 下面2行代码,没有指定webpackChunkName,每个组件打包成一个js文件。const ImportFuncDemo1 = () => import('../components/...
- 2021-07-15 16:55Silence_555的博客 Vue路由中引入组件Component的三种方式
- 2021-12-08 17:37回答 1 已采纳 打包的时候就生成了app.js,打包会生成dist文件夹,app.js.就在里面,然后把dist部署到服务器望采纳^O^有问题再沟通
- 2022-03-10 23:07回答 3 已采纳 你这个是依赖的目录,一般这里都不用看。main.js在src目录下
- 2022-02-22 17:35回答 3 已采纳 在router.js配置meta { path: '/teachers', name: 'TDetail', component: TDetail, m
- 2022-03-25 21:44skies_7的博客 1 按需加载的好处 在页面加载时,可以减少js文件的加载量,实现更快的响应速度。 应用场景: 比如应用的首页里面有个按钮,点击后可以打开某个地图。打开地图的话就要利用百度地图的js,于是我们不得不在首页中把...
- 2022-03-02 10:15剑九 六千里的博客 文章目录1 vue实现按需加载1.1 vue-router配置resolve+require加载 (vue组件异步加载方式)1.2 ES6的import()方法1.3 webpake提供的resolve + require.ensure()1.4 组件的按需加载1.5 导入组件的懒加载 1 vue实现按...
- 2021-02-13 14:15未央朝云的博客 使用vue-cli构建项目后,我们会在Router文件夹下面的index.js里面引入相关的路由组件,如: import Hello from ‘@/components/Hello’ import Boy from ‘@/components/Boy...1、require.ensure()实现按需加载 语法: r
- 2022-02-22 10:45回答 3 已采纳 import atomApi from 'api/atomService.js;然后 atomApi.方法名
- 2022-04-10 23:19回答 1 已采纳 注意看这个:"TypeError: Cannot read properties of undefined (reading 'getAttribute')" 。看看你getAttribute方法有
- 2022-02-12 17:14回答 3 已采纳 v-on:click="count++;console.log(count)"
- 2018-11-05 20:42朽木·露琪亚的博客 有时候打包出来的js文件过大,严重影响访问速度,这个时候我们就不得不...下面就主要说以下vue组件异步加载的方法:(测试所用的webpack:^4.12.0) 1.使用() => import() 代码: 打包: 界面效果: 2.使...
- 2020-08-07 22:51星河_赵梓宇的博客 Vue性能优化:图片与组件,如何实现按需加载? 前沿:按需加载是性能优化其中的一个环节,可以是图片的按需加载,也就是lazyload来实现按需加载的场景,也可以是组件库的引入,只需部分组件的使用而无需全局引入...
- 2021-06-17 13:14yazhiShaw的博客 像vue这种单页面应用,用构建工具打包之后的包会非常大,导致网页白屏时间过长,影响用户体验,而运用懒加载则可以将页面进行划分,需要的时候加载页面,可以有效的分担首页所承担的加载压力,减少首页加载用时 ...
- 2022-04-07 15:57回答 3 已采纳 可以正常显示的,修改一下代码: var that = this; axios.post('/colrank/',{ }).then(function (response) {
- 2018-04-25 21:48Chepy2018的博客 按需加载:1. 将重量级路由内容单独生成一个或者多个js文件,而不是全部放在app.js中;2. 路由访问时再去加载对应的代码块。webpack打包会自动将所有依赖的JS代码打入一个文件,如果工程特别大,依赖的内容特别多的...
- 没有解决我的问题, 去提问